Chilean Salsa Verde

Chilean Salsa Verde or Green Sauce

Description

A great sauce for meats, sandwiches, and raw seafood.


Ingredients

  • 1/2 medium onion
  • 1 generous bunch of parsley
  • vegetable oil
  • salt
  • white wine vinegar or lemon juice
  • Sweet banana pepper and or garlic chopped small, optional

Instructions

  1. Peel and chop the onion into tiny cubes. Add boiling water and let stand for 3 minutes. Drain and run under cold water. Drain well.

  2. Wash and pat dry the parsley, cut and discard the stems. Chop leaves tiny.

  3. Mix the onion, parsley, garlic, and pepper if using. Stir well after adding one tablespoon of oil, salt, and one teaspoon of vinegar or lemon juice.

  4. Stir well and adjust the seasoning to taste.
